The Pines Condo in Kuala Lumpur, Kuala Lumpur recorded 5 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M 530K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 517.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 530K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 520K to RM 540K, and a typical market range of RM 525K to RM 535K.

Most transactions involved condominium/apartment, with minimal variety in property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 517, with most transactions between RM 510 and RM 524. The usual range is RM 512.69 to RM 521.69,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M 9.00 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M 7 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
